Method
Thread beef and capsicums onto skewers. In a bowl whisk marinade ingredients together.
Brush marinade over skewers, then place on a lined baking tray and leave to marinate in the fridge for at least 30 minutes. Reserve marinade for basting.
Whisk salad dressing in a small jug until well combined.
Place all prepared salad ingredients in a serving bowl and toss with salad dressing.
Preheat the barbecue or grilled pan to high. Cook the skewers for 10 minutes, turning and brushing with remaining marinade every few minutes, until beef is browned and cooked to your liking.
Serve hot with extra Lee Kum Kee Char Siu Sauce drizzled over and the cucumber salad served on the side.
